The Issue

I live in a heavily built up area in Shirley West Midlands.... luckily we have a beautiful line of mature trees that line the back of our houses ... this space has given me and my young boys much needed natural play especially over lockdown.... It is also a space used by many families in the local area with children and for walking dogs..... Solihull council are planning a development of 450 houses within this area phase 1 of this development has already began.... phase 2 is going to include cutting down the majority of the trees that line the back of our houses.... the only outside play space the council intend to put there will be a small concrete playground.... this disappoints me for so many reasons the environmental issues we are all facing are so apparent to us all and it just seems unethical to cut down such beautiful mature trees within this climate... by cutting these trees down it’s taking away a natural playground for the small children in the direct area.... also as there is going to be 450 more families with noise pollution and more pollution within the direct area the trees will be needed more than ever to counteract this..... and finally the many birds squirrels and wildlife that find home within these trees will have it taken away ....
